Step 1: Click on C# to Cut-n-paste code into clsStartsWith.cs

using System;
public class clsStartsWith
{
 
    public void Main()
    {
 
 
 
        //****************************************************************************************
        // Example #1: StartsWith(string)
        // Returns a Boolean value that indicates if the string starts with the specified string. 
        //****************************************************************************************
 
        Console.WriteLine("Example #1: stringtoexamine.StartsWith(string) ");
 
        string strStartsWithExample = "This is a test string";
 
        Console.WriteLine(strStartsWithExample.StartsWith("This")); //Returns True
 
        //write blank line to make output easier to read
        Console.WriteLine();
 
        //Prevent console from closing before you press enter
        Console.ReadLine();
 
    }
 
 
}
